1. Risk Assessment and Vulnerability Analysis
One of the core functions of a cybersecurity consultancy is identifying where a business is most exposed to threats. Consultants conduct detailed risk assessments to evaluate systems, networks, applications, and processes.
This includes:
- Identifying weak points in the IT infrastructure
- Assessing potential cyber threats, such as malware or phishing
- Reviewing access controls and user permissions
- Analysing third-party and supplier risks
By understanding vulnerabilities early, businesses can prioritize security investments and reduce the likelihood of cyber incidents before they occur.
2. Cybersecurity Strategy and Governance
Cybersecurity is not just a technical issue—it is a business strategy issue. Consultants help organizations design structured cybersecurity frameworks that align with business goals.
Key components include:
- Developing long-term cybersecurity roadmaps
- Establishing governance policies and security standards
- Defining roles and responsibilities within the organization
- Aligning cybersecurity with business objectives and growth plans
Strong governance ensures that cybersecurity decisions are consistent, measurable, and aligned with risk appetite and regulatory requirements.
3. Compliance and Regulatory Support
Many industries are subject to strict data protection and cybersecurity regulations. Failure to comply can lead to legal penalties, financial loss, and reputational damage. Cybersecurity consultants help organizations navigate this complex landscape.
They assist with:
- Compliance with data protection laws and industry standards
- Implementation of security frameworks and best practices
- Preparation for audits and regulatory assessments
- Documentation of security policies and procedures
This ensures businesses remain compliant while also strengthening their overall security posture.
4. Incident Response and Cyber Recovery Planning
Even with strong security measures, cyber incidents can still occur. A key part of consultancy services is preparing businesses to respond effectively when attacks happen.
Consultants support organizations by:
- Developing incident response plans
- Defining escalation procedures during cyber attacks
- Supporting containment and recovery strategies
- Conducting post-incident analysis to prevent future attacks
A well-prepared response plan helps reduce downtime, limit financial loss, and restore operations more efficiently.
5. Security Awareness and Employee Training
Human error remains one of the leading causes of cyber incidents. Many attacks, such as phishing and social engineering, rely on manipulating employees rather than exploiting systems directly.
Cybersecurity consultancy often includes training programs such as:
- Phishing awareness education
- Password security best practices
- Safe internet and email usage
- Data handling and privacy awareness
By improving employee awareness, organizations significantly reduce the risk of accidental breaches.
6. Cloud and Infrastructure Security
As businesses increasingly adopt cloud platforms and remote working environments, securing digital infrastructure has become more complex. Cybersecurity consultants help organizations manage these challenges effectively.
Their support may include:
- Cloud security assessments and configuration reviews
- Network security design and optimization
- Endpoint protection strategies
- Secure remote access solutions
This ensures that modern IT environments remain protected, scalable, and resilient against evolving threats.
